Bitcoin’s Path to $1.5 Million: Is It Possible?
In Ark Invest’s latest report, Cathie Wood projects Bitcoin could reach $1.5 million by 2030. Achieving this requires a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 58% over the next six years.

How High Can Bitcoin Go?
Bullish Price Scenarios Based on Institutional Adoption
Ark Invest’s report outlines multiple scenarios for Bitcoin’s price potential based on its adoption rate among institutional investors:
1️⃣ Base Case: If institutions allocate 5% of their portfolios to Bitcoin, the price could reach $680,000 by 2030.
2️⃣ Bull Case: If institutional allocation increases to 10%, Bitcoin could hit $1.5 million.
3️⃣ Extreme Bull Case: If Bitcoin achieves 15-20% allocation, it could surpass $2.5 million per BTC.
The biggest unknown variable is how fast institutions ramp up adoption. If the trend continues as it has in 2023-2024, these projections may not be far-fetched.
Potential Risks to Consider
While Bitcoin’s long-term outlook remains highly optimistic, investors should also be aware of potential risks:
⚠️ Regulatory Challenges
- Governments could introduce restrictive regulations, impacting Bitcoin’s accessibility.
- Higher taxation on crypto assets could reduce investment demand.
⚠️ Market Volatility
- Bitcoin is known for sharp price swings, which could test investor patience.
- Short-term corrections of 20-30% are common in bull cycles.
⚠️ Technological and Security Risks
- Advances in quantum computing could pose risks to Bitcoin’s cryptographic security.
- Cybersecurity threats remain a concern for exchanges and wallet providers.
To mitigate risks, investors should take a long-term approach, diversify their holdings, and secure their Bitcoin in trusted custody solutions.
